Ten years in the making and Axel Rose, along with the new line-up of Guns N’ Roses, officially release Chinese Democracy. Say what you will about Axel and the boys, but they are without a doubt one of the greatest American rock groups of the 1980’s — if not all time.

Best of all — and the reason why I’m posting this on KABOBfest — is the fact that G n’ R dedicated the release of their new album and title track to “those fighting oppression” and even teamed with B’Tselem and UNRWA to produce a video that shows the carnage of daily life in Palestine.
